Real-Time GIF Viewer & Generator

Create, preview, edit and download GIFs instantly

Real-Time Active
GIF Preview

No GIF loaded. Upload images or use sample GIF to begin.

No GIF loaded
Real-Time Controls
Animation Speed
Slow 200ms Fast
Loop Count
Infinite Infinite 10x
Image Scaling
10% 100% 100%
Quality / Size
Small Medium Large
Upload Images

Drag & drop images here

or click to browse (JPG, PNG, GIF)

Quick Actions:

GIF Information
Dimensions: N/A
File Size: N/A
Frame Count: N/A
Duration: N/A
Status: No GIF loaded
Advanced Settings

How to Use the GIF Viewer & Generator

Our Real-Time GIF Viewer & Generator is a powerful tool that allows you to create, edit, and preview animated GIFs instantly. Follow this guide to make the most of all the advanced features.

Step-by-Step Instructions:
1. Upload Your Images

Click the upload area or drag and drop multiple image files (JPG, PNG, or GIF). You can also use the "Load Sample GIF" button to quickly test the tool with a preloaded animation.

2. Adjust Animation Settings

Use the real-time controls to adjust speed, loop count, scaling, and quality. Changes are applied instantly so you can see exactly how your GIF will look.

3. Preview & Playback

Use the play/pause button to control animation playback. The progress bar shows the current frame position in the animation sequence.

4. Apply Advanced Settings

Toggle advanced options like auto-play, reverse animation, and web optimization. Adjust the frame rate for smoother or smaller file size animations.

5. Generate Your GIF

Click "Generate GIF Now" to process your images into a final GIF. The tool will optimize the animation based on your selected settings.

6. Download & Share

Once satisfied with your GIF, click the download button to save it to your device. The GIF information panel shows detailed stats about your creation.

Pro Tips:
  • For smaller file sizes, reduce the scale and quality settings
  • Use 10-15 FPS for most animations to balance smoothness and file size
  • Enable "Optimize for web" to reduce file size without noticeable quality loss
  • Set loop count to 0 for infinite looping animations